18 Aralık 2018 Salı

Time in postgresql

Time zones, and time -zone conventions, are influenced by political decisions, not just earth geometry. It returns the actual current time , and therefore its value changes even within a single SQL command. The NOW() function returns the current date and time. The return type of the NOW() function is the timestamp with time zone. This means that the type has precision for milliseconds in the value.


Variables affecting Date and Time data types in postgresql. Notice two words for TIME ZONE where the code above uses a single word timezone. For formatting functions, refer to Section 9. PostgreSQL short hand for ‘with time zone’. I have a time value 04:30:that I want to convert to seconds.


The time zone notion in particular is mainly a political tool these days, and it makes no sense on an engineering principle: there’s no. Is there any dedicated function to do this? I know that we can extract hours, minutes and seconds, then calculate the seconds.


This is the first in a series of performance benchmarks comparing TimescaleDB to other databases for storing and analyzing time-series data. TimescaleDB is a new, open-source time-series database architected for fast ingest, complex queries, and ease of use. Using Java Date and Time classes. Dates are counted according to the Gregorian calendar.


To understand the difference is a very important. Otherwise, it will affect your business or dataset. I found many people are using TIMESTAMP WITH TIME ZONE data time , without knowing that this data type will change the time value according to different TIME ZONEs.


Today, for the first time , we are publicly sharing our design, plans, and benchmarks for the distributed version of TimescaleDB. Convert Unix time to a readable date. Also known as Point- In - Time Recovery or PITR.


It offers all the advanced features generally needed in the enterprise world. The ability to perform backup and restore of your data is one of the fundamental requirements of any DBMS. Just- in - Time (JIT) compilation is the process of turning some form of interpreted program evaluation into a native program, and doing so at runtime. To force the use of mixed or upper case identifiers, you must escape the identifier using double quotes (). Contrary to what the name suggests, timestamp with time zone does not store the time zone.


Time in postgresql

The difference between the two types lies in the semantics and is often a source of confusion. Also, it could save a lot of time because the replay of WALs is much faster than rebuilding an entire instance. I double-checked that postgresql.


My query seemed impossible! Down was up, up was down, Pacific Time suddenly had no meaning, and I imagined a bunch of National Time Service. The log records every change made to the database’s data files. To enable it, use this line in your postgresql.


The easiest way to use this image is in conjunction with the pg_prometheus docker image provided by Timescale. The idea is: If a query takes longer than a certain amount of time, a line will be sent to the log. Elixir and functional programming are his areas of expertise. Handling time zones is hard in any environment I worked with.


Part of the problem is that time zones are political construct rather than geographical one, and as such - they change. BSD well, the problem is that now in this release CURRENT_TIME return high precision time, is it possible to have only HH:MM:SS its for backguards compatibility. If your programming language is Java, you most likely wince at the very thought of date arithmetic.


Time in postgresql

In this artilce we present, how cool is date arithmetic in postgreSQL. Fixed unnecessary failures or slow connections when multiple target host names are used in libpq so that the DNS lookup happens one at a time but not all at once.

Hiç yorum yok:

Yorum Gönder

Not: Yalnızca bu blogun üyesi yorum gönderebilir.

Popüler Yayınlar